Hey OP - Can confirm that my '25 Limited FT 4WD has been running perfectly ever since purchase. Already changed the oil twice as I heard towards 10K miles

My only "issues" have been
  1. A rattle on the passenger side when I play loud bass/music. It stops once someone sits there or you press down on the door just a touch. Plan on addressing next service at 10K miles
  2. Transmission can be a bit jerky when driving from cold start. If you let it warm up or put it into sports mode, it goes away. Not a huge deal at all, but something I noticed with these trucks
I wish the auto start/stop would remember every time I turn it off as I have to do it whenever I start her up. Same thing with my drive/comfort settings, but these things IMO could be resolved with a software update.
